Method: VagrantPlugins::Shell::Action::TimedProvision#run_provisioner

Defined in:
lib/vagrant-shell/action/timed_provision.rb

#run_provisioner(env, name, p) ⇒ Object



9
10
11
12
13
14
15
16
17
# File 'lib/vagrant-shell/action/timed_provision.rb', line 9

def run_provisioner(env, name, p)
  timer = Util::Timer.time do
    super
  end

  env[:metrics] ||= {}
  env[:metrics]["provisioner_times"] ||= []
  env[:metrics]["provisioner_times"] << [name, timer]
end